Pasco Detectives Find Skimmers At 3 Gas Stations

LAND O' LAKES, FL - Pasco detectives conducted a sweep of 70 gas pumps recently throughout the county, finding skimmers at three gas stations located in eastern Pasco County. Each detective with the sheriff's Economic Crimes Unit was paired with a petroleum inspector during the sweep.

A skimmer is a device affixed to a gas pump that secretly swipes credit and debit card information when customers slip their cards into the machines.

The three gas stations were:

One skimmer at the 7-Eleven: 38544 5th Ave,, Zephyrhills. Pump No. 1, facing the store's door;
Two skimmers at the Topking Food Mart/Chevron: 11744 Fort King Road, Dade City. Pump No. 3 and Pump No. 4, pump station on the Northeast side;
Two skimmers at the BP: 4109 Land O' Lakes Blvd., Land O' Lakes. Pump No. 5 and Pump No. 7, this pump station is the second pump station from the north side of the business.
